What is a computer aide?

Computer Aides are support professionals who assist with basic computer operations, troubleshooting, and maintenance in various settings such as schools, offices, or IT departments. Their tasks typically include setting up hardware, installing software, providing user support, and maintaining computer equipment. They often help ensure that computer systems run smoothly and may assist in resolving technical problems or performing routine updates. Computer Aides may also provide training or guidance to users who are less familiar with technology.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a computer aide?

To thrive as a Computer Aide, you need a solid understanding of basic computer operations, troubleshooting, and often at least a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with common operating systems, office software, and sometimes help desk ticketing systems or basic networking tools is typically required. Strong communication, problem-solving abilities, and patience are essential soft skills for assisting users and resolving technical issues. These competencies ensure efficient support, minimize downtime, and enhance the overall productivity of the organization.

What are some typical challenges faced by computer aides and how can they be addressed?

Computer Aides often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ting a wide variety of hardware and software issues under time constraints, assisting users with varying levels of technical knowledge, and managing multiple support requests simultaneously. To address these challenges, it's important to develop strong communication skills, stay organized, and maintain up-to-date knowledge of common IT systems and troubleshooting methods. Many Computer Aides also benefit from collaborating closely with other IT staff and utilizing ticketing systems to prioritize and track issues efficiently.

What is the difference between Computer Aide vs Computer Technician?

AspectComputer AideComputer Technician
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; certifications like A+ optionalHigh school diploma; certifications like A+ or Network+ often required
Work EnvironmentAssists in hardware/software setup, basic troubleshooting, often in educational or support settingsPerforms repairs, diagnostics, and maintenance in repair shops, offices, or client sites
Job ResponsibilitiesSupports computer setup, installs software, basic troubleshootingDiagnoses hardware/software issues, repairs, upgrades, and system maintenance
Industry UsageEducational institutions, support roles, entry-level IT supportIT service providers, repair shops, corporate IT departments

While both roles support computer systems, a Computer Aide typically assists with basic setup and troubleshooting, often in educational or support environments. A Computer Technician performs more advanced diagnostics, repairs, and maintenance, requiring more technical skills and certifications.
